The Two Sides of Fire Alarm Installation
I often explain to learners that fire alarm installation has two pillarsโthe installation side and the electrical side.
The Installation Side
This is the practical, hands-on craft:
- Designing systems with smoke, heat, or multi-sensor detectors.
- Positioning alarms and sounders for effective coverage.
- Running fire-resistant cables safely.
- Commissioning systems to BS 5839 standards.

The Electrical Side
This is where compliance and safety come in:
- Following the 18th Edition Wiring Regulations (BS 7671).
- Ensuring safe mains connections and battery backups.
- Integrating alarms with sprinklers, security, and emergency lighting.
- Meeting Part P Building Regulations.

Why BAFE Certification Matters
Training gives you skills. Certification proves your competence.
The BAFE Register is the UKโs leading independent fire safety certification.
- SP203-1 covers commercial systems (BS 5839-1).
- DS301 covers domestic systems (BS 5839-6).
While not legally required (BAFE FAQ), Iโve seen how BAFE certification gives contractors credibilityโparticularly in areas like London, Hertfordshire, and Essex, where local authorities and housing providers increasingly expect it.

Career Prospects and Salaries
- Entry-level installers in the UK start at ยฃ25,000+.
- Experienced engineers in areas like London and Hertfordshire often earn ยฃ40,000โยฃ50,000+.
- Self-employed contractors can earn more, especially with BAFE certification.

Whatโs the difference between BS 5839-1 and BS 5839-6?
- BS 5839-6 covers domestic premises.
- BS 5839-1 covers commercial/non-domestic premises.
